Boston Breakers forward Adriana Leon has been nominated for Canada Soccer’s 2017 player of the year.
It’s a very nice nod to a player who was seemingly out of the squad a couple of years ago but worked her way back in, notching three goals in six games for her country on top of six goals and six assists for her club.
